A recent Inc. Magazine article highlighted something many leaders overlook: People want to feel seen.

In our experience, one of the earliest signs of disengagement isn't poor performance. It's when employees stop feeling connected to the impact of their work.

As organizations grow, that disconnect can happen gradually and unintentionally.
